The Federal Government on Friday extended the travel ban on 15 countries to place a restriction on international flights to Murtala Muhammad International Airport Lagos and Nnamdi Azikwe International Airport, Abuja.

Minister of Health, Dr Osagie Ehanire, announced this in a chat with reporters, adding that the move was part of precautionary measures to contain the spread of COVID-19 in Nigeria.
He declared that international flights will be only through the two airports until further notice.
